How Experts Make a Difference
Experienced professionals understand weed growth cycles. While some spread above ground through seed, others regrow from underground roots. Knowing what you're dealing with allows for tailored treatment while protecting nearby vegetation.
By applying substances responsibly, professional teams use approved formulations and carry out treatments with precision. Public access points such as streams are always taken into account. For many, the reassurance that all steps are controlled is just as valuable as the visible outcome.

Managing Weed Growth Through the Seasons
The warmer seasons bring rapid expansion. Tackling weeds before they flower keeps populations down. However, work doesn’t stop when the weather cools. Late-season treatments disrupt regrowth potential, cutting spring issues.
By taking a seasonal approach, you retain control regardless of the time of year.
